Salem Health’s Monmouth Family Medicine Clinic is seeking an accomplished Nurse Practitioner or Physician Associate to join our dedicated care team. Our current group includes one Family Medicine Physician, and two Nurse Practitioners. You will manage a full patient panel with a schedule that remains flexible and adjustable based on patient and clinic needs. As the only primary care providers serving a community of approximately 10,000 residents, our clinicians play a critical role in ensuring access to comprehensive, high‑quality medical services.
Providers also benefit from being a part of Salem Health Medical Group, a strong network of more than 250 clinicians across 16 specialties, all committed to delivering exceptional patient experiences and evidence‑based care.
- Provide comprehensive primary care, including wellness exams, chronic disease management, and acute care.
- Obtain and document patient histories, perform physical exams, and establish treatment plans.
- Order and interpret diagnostic tests, prescribe medications, and perform minor procedures.
- Educate patients and families on health conditions, prevention, and treatment options.
- Collaborate with physicians and care team members to ensure coordinated, high‑quality care.
- Participate in clinic initiatives, protocol development, and professional development activities.
Nurse Practitioner (NP):
- Master’s degree or higher in Nursing or equivalent field recognized by the Oregon Board of Nursing.
- Completion of a Nurse Practitioner program recognized by the Oregon Board of Nursing.
- Current, unencumbered RN license and NP certificate in the State of Oregon.
- Valid NP national certification and DEA registration.
- At least 12 months relevant hospital experience in the past three years.
- If the Nurse Practitioner does not have the relevant hospital experience and cannot otherwise document current competency, a monitoring plan may be required.
- Current American Heart Association ACLS certification.
Physician Associate (PA):
- Graduation from an ARC-PA–accredited Physician Associate program.
- At least 12 months relevant inpatient experience in the past three years.
- If the Physician Associate does not have the relevant hospital experience and cannot otherwise document current competency, a monitoring plan may be required.
- Successful completion of the Physician Associate National Certifying Exam (PANCE).
- Current certification by NCCPA, Oregon PA license, and DEA registration.
